Description

Expand your understanding of political science with Comparative Politics: Rationality, Culture, and Structure. Published by Cambridge University Press, this academic text provides a focused look at the fundamental elements that shape political systems around the world. This book is designed for students and researchers looking to explore how different factors influence political outcomes. By examining the relationship between rationality, cultural influences, and structural frameworks, readers gain a clearer view of how governments and political ideologies function in practice. Whether you are studying for a degree or researching specific political theories, this resource offers a structured approach to understanding complex global systems. It serves as a foundational tool for anyone interested in the deep study of government and political science.
